Just seen this elderly thread! Worth saying that the regular Touch remote (and I guess other Squeeze remotes too...) has that Sleep button - and all the remotes work for all of the devices. So a Touch remote will control a Radio too, if you don't have that mini remote sold as a Radio add-on. I push for 15 mins sleep, 2 for 30 etc etc, up to 90. Though, as others have noted, you can simply put Sleep at the top of the Home menu.
